
It was a dominating day for Michael Addamo at the final table of this week’s GGPoker Super MILLION$ as he eliminated every single player at the table en route to his record-best fourth career Super MILLION$ title and the $325,957 first-place prize.
In his tenth appearance in the $10,000 GGPoker Super MILLION$, and his first final table, Hungary’s David Szep outlasted this week’s field of 105 entries to capture his first Super MLLION$ title and the $228,170 first-place prize.

The GGPoker Spring Festival may be over, but the massive paydays on GGPoker continue as the 47th edition of the GGPoker Super MILLION$ wrapped up on Tuesday with Wiktor ‘limitless’ Malinowski running white-hot to topple the 184-entry field and the take home $394,852 first-place prize.
Isaac Haxton must have seen all of the top players winning GGPoker Spring Festival events and decided to finally throw his hat into the ring. After posting one runner-up finish and three third place finishes, Haxton broke through into the winner’s circle to take home nearly a quarter of a million dollars.
